This week on Decentralize with Cointelegraph, we’re diving into the often-overlooked engine behind crypto’s public perception: opinion pieces. Joining us are Cath Jenkin, Cointelegraph’s opinion editor; Nikki Brown, chief strategy officer of Melrose PR; and Amal Ibraymi, legal counsel at Aztec Network. Together, we unpack the true power of op-eds in shaping discourse, influencing policy and guiding readers through the chaos of crypto commentary.
We’ll explore:
Whether you’re a founder, a reader or a would-be op-ed contributor, this episode offers a behind-the-scenes look at how narratives are built and who’s writing them.
